The US has said when Trump and Putin may talk

A conversation between US President Donald Trump and Russian dictator Vladimir Putin is expected next week.

This was stated by the US President's special envoy Steve Witkoff, RBC-Ukraine reports with reference to an interview with CNN.

When asked by a reporter about the time frame for the agreement, specifically whether it would take weeks or possibly months, Witkoff responded that President Trump uses the term “weeks” and he does not intend to argue with him.

Witkoff also expressed hope that real progress will be made on this issue in the near future.

“I think everyone should focus on the progress that has been made since the president was inaugurated. No one expected such rapid progress,” he said.

The special envoy also added that the situation with the war in Ukraine is extremely difficult, but, according to him, the United States is still closing the gap between the two sides.

“There are still a lot of issues to discuss, but I think the two presidents will have a really good and constructive conversation this week ,” he said.

Witkoff's visit to Moscow

Let us recall that on March 13, Witkoff was sent to Moscow to convey to Russian dictator Vladimir Putin the US proposal for a 30-day ceasefire. Let us note that this is already Steve Witkoff's second visit to Russia.

It should be noted that, according to Western media, the US President's special envoy waited eight hours to meet with Putin, who in the meantime was meeting with the self-proclaimed leader of Belarus, Alexander Lukashenko.

His visit was planned after US-Ukrainian talks in Saudi Arabia on March 11, during which a 30-day ceasefire on the front in Ukraine was agreed upon. The US also resumed military aid and intelligence sharing with Ukraine.
